Description
The Mammography Department belongs to the clinic for imaging and functional medicine and is part of the breast center together with surgical and pathology services.
The close collaboration within the breast center enables a short care flow where patients are usually both investigated for breast cancer and receive results from the examination on the same day.
The Mammography Department's mission is to offer screening with mammography to women aged 40-74 years. Screening is performed at the department as well as at two mobile units that together have about 15 different setup locations in NU Healthcare's catchment area. Clinical examinations and screenings are performed at the department.
We continuously work on workplace environment issues, improvement work, networking with other mammography departments, as well as positioning and image quality, among other things. A good working environment for everyone is important in mammography. We work in teams, so great importance is placed on good cohesion and common goals.
Responsibilities
Standard duties as a radiographer/nurse in the mammography department. Responsibilities include screening, clinical imaging, and assisting in clinical examinations and ultrasounds.
The position involves working with mammography both in the mobile units and at the department, breast center. Working hours are during the day, evening shifts occur in the mobile units. Overnight stays occur when placed in the mobile units about 4 nights a month.
Qualifications
Licensed radiographer or licensed nurse. Experience in mammography and radiation protection training is advantageous. The position requires good knowledge of Swedish in both spoken and written form.
You who are applying should have an easy time communicating and have good collaboration skills as well as being confident in your independent work. You should be flexible and have a situationally adapted working method. The work is physically demanding, especially for arms and shoulders. You have a genuine interest in people, a good attitude, and are responsive to women/patients' wishes and needs.
A driver's license is required. Driving occurs frequently in all weather conditions, both morning and evening to the mobile units.
We place great emphasis on personal suitability.
